BCSTech - 9-30-2011 at 10:34 PM

Quote:
Originally posted by Russ
Does it work with Hughes Net? Worry about the FAP.
Russ, you'll eat up your FAP allowance in a hurry. Even if you could stream the required 300 to 500 Kb down over HughesNet, a typical movie is around 1 to 2 GB.
